Addressing technical concerns and procurement queries with transparency.
A: OCPP 1.6J is the current industry standard for basic communication. OCPP 2.0.1 introduces enhanced security, advanced device management, and support for ISO 15118 (Plug & Charge), which we integrate for future-proof commercial installations.
A: An IP65 rating ensures the station is completely dust-tight and protected against water jets. This significantly reduces maintenance intervals in outdoor or dusty industrial environments, leading to a lower Total Cost of Ownership (TCO).
A: Yes. Our chargers use CT clamps or smart meters to monitor solar production, automatically adjusting the charging rate to match the available green energy surplus, preventing grid draw.
A: We provide full CE (LVD/EMC) and RoHS for Europe, and are currently expanding UL/ETL compliant designs for North America, ensuring seamless grid connection and local incentive eligibility.
